Extra Tips for Happy Planting
You’ve got the gear! Here are a few more quick tips to boost your confidence.
Start with Easy Plants
Some plants are tougher than others. If you’re new to houseplants, begin with forgiving ones like Snake Plants, ZZ Plants, Pothos, or Spider Plants. They can handle a few beginner mistakes while you learn.
Get the Light Right
Light is crucial! Most houseplants like bright, indirect light – near a sunny window, but not getting blasted by direct sun all day. Check the plant tag or do a quick search for its specific needs.
Water Smart, Not Hard
Overwatering is a common mistake. Use a tool like the soil meter (#7) or simply stick your finger about an inch into the soil. If it feels dry, it’s likely time to water. Water thoroughly until it drains from the bottom, then let it dry out appropriately before watering again.
Don’t Panic Over Small Stuff
A yellow leaf or a few brown tips happen. It doesn’t mean you’ve failed! Often it’s a sign the plant needs slightly different watering, light, or humidity. Look it up, adjust, and learn. Plant care is a journey!
